So what exactly are habits?
Habits are actions that we take without thinking. They can be wanted or unwanted, but whatever they are, we tend to take them for granted. Sometimes they can help us - for example, imagine how much time we would spend if every time we got up in the morning we had to learn how to walk?
When we were born we could only perform very basic functions essential for life - to alert someone that we needed food, water, warmth, cleaning and sleep. However, we were also born with a great capacity for learning, and our habits are one of the results of that learning.
Walking was probably one of the first habits you mastered. Even though you didn't succeed first time, and probably fell over, you didn't give up, you kept going. Consider how many people give up trying to break a habit when something goes wrong and they lull back to old ways. If we had that attitude when we where learning to walk then none of us would have got up. We would all be on the floor sucking fluff!
Breaking your Habits is as easy as learning them...
You can break your habit if you are willing to consider a new perspective:
- Remember you were not born with your bad habit, you learned it and you can unlearn it.
- You've practised your habit to the extent that you are good and skilled at it. Now is the time to stop and become good at doing something else.
- Don't look for scapegoats and blame others, be willing and responsible for breaking your unwanted habit.
- Don't label your habits good or bad, they are just things you do. The question is "do you wish to carry on doing them?"
- It doesn’t matter whether you believe that you can or you believe that you can't. Either way, you're right. Remember you get what you focus on. If you focus on how hard and difficult it is to break a habit then that's exactly how it will be.
- The best way to end a habit is to first imagine yourself having conquered it. Take the time to imagine yourself being in total control. Act it out in your mind.
- Repetition is the mother of all skills so when you've acted it out in your mind many times, just like an actor would, then take the time to act it out for real.
- Remember success is often only just on the other side of failure, so don't expect to get everything right straight away. If you make a mistake and take a backwards step, then learn from it and move on.
- Be patient and give yourself the opportunity and the time to change.
